Flow Assurance Challenges in an Oil and Gas Gathering System
Flow assurance refers to the strategies, technologies, and operational practices used to ensure the uninterrupted and efficient flow of hydrocarbons from wells to processing facilities. In oil and gas gathering systems, multiple wells transport crude oil, natural gas, water, and other byproducts through a network of pipelines to central processing units. Because these systems often operate under varying pressures, temperatures, and fluid compositions, maintaining steady flow can be complex. Effective flow assurance is essential to prevent production losses, equipment damage, and safety risks.

Common Flow Assurance Challenges
Oil and gas gathering systems face several flow-related challenges that can disrupt production. One of the most common problems is the formation of hydrates, which occur when water and gas combine under high pressure and low temperature to form solid crystalline structures. Hydrates can block pipelines and significantly restrict flow.
Another major issue is wax deposition. As crude oil cools while traveling through pipelines, paraffin wax can precipitate and accumulate on pipe walls. Over time, this buildup narrows the internal diameter of the pipeline, increasing pressure drop and potentially leading to complete blockage.
Scale formation is also a frequent challenge. Minerals dissolved in produced water can precipitate as pressure and temperature change, forming hard deposits inside pipelines and equipment. These deposits reduce flow efficiency and increase maintenance requirements.
Impact of Flow Assurance Problems
Flow assurance issues can have serious operational and financial consequences. Blockages or restricted flow may reduce production rates or force operators to temporarily shut down wells. In severe cases, pipelines may need to be depressurized and cleaned, leading to costly downtime.
Additionally, excessive pressure buildup caused by obstructions can damage pipelines or valves. This increases the risk of leaks, environmental incidents, and safety hazards for field personnel. Therefore, early detection and mitigation of flow problems are critical to maintaining reliable operations.
Strategies for Managing Flow Assurance
Operators use a combination of engineering design, chemical treatment, and monitoring technologies to manage flow assurance challenges. Pipeline insulation and heating systems can help maintain temperatures above wax or hydrate formation points. Chemical inhibitors are frequently injected to prevent hydrate formation, reduce wax deposition, and control scale.
Pigging operations are another important method for maintaining flow. Pipeline inspection gauges (pigs) are sent through pipelines to physically remove deposits and inspect pipeline conditions. Regular pigging helps keep pipelines clear and ensures consistent flow performance.
Role of Monitoring and Digital Technologies
Modern gathering systems increasingly rely on digital monitoring solutions to improve flow assurance. Sensors placed throughout pipelines can measure temperature, pressure, and flow rates in real time. This data allows operators to detect abnormal conditions early and take corrective actions before serious blockages occur.
Advanced analytics and predictive modeling tools also help forecast potential flow issues. By analyzing operational data, engineers can anticipate hydrate formation risks or wax deposition trends and adjust operating conditions proactively.
